Never touch a dead whale!

No one should ever be near one, unless they’re some sort of marine expert.

You see, when a large whale dies, their carcass usually provides a great source of food for Marine life. In other times though, they end up on shore.

No alt text provided for this image

While this is happening, gases begin to build up inside the carcass as its inner organs begin to decompose. But because a whale has thick skin and a tough layer of fat, the gases continue to build up inside the whale's body causing it to appear bloated. Eventually though, the pressure becomes so intense that this might happen.
